Responsibilities The Mad Money Segment Producer will book top-caliber guests and produce related segments for CNBC's dynamic, fast-paced hit show.
Responsibilities
could include, but are not limited to:
• Developing and producing live and taped guest segments
• Generating original content ideas daily, tapping into a broad array of sources
• Identifying and booking compelling guests
• Conducting pre-interviews of guests and arranging for any necessary travel
• Writing compelling copy and teases
• Securing elements such as sound bites and video to support segments
• Partnering with other departments as needed (Graphics, Tech Ops, Satellite Operations)
• Developing and maintaining good relationships with news sources
• Assisting Line Producers in the production of the show Qualifications/Requirements • At least 5 years of experience booking and segment producing in a live television environment, with demonstrated writing, research and communication skills
• Exemplary editorial judgment
• Successful candidates will be self-starters with superior contacts who can work effectively and creatively under daily deadline pressure
• Excellent interpersonal skills, combined with a strong sense of how to visually tell a compelling story
• Willingness to accommodate a demanding production schedule and flexibility to work weekends and some holidays when and as required
• Must be willing to work in Englewood Cliffs, NJ-perks include free shuttle, free gym, dry cleaning/shoe shine services, full-service cafeteria, food trucks, and more! Desired Characteristics • Some experience as a Line Producer--this individual will ideally serve as back-up LP
• Strong understanding of the markets and prior experience at a financial news network
